NEC announces £90m mega complex

The NEC Group has revealed plans for a massive £90m leisure and entertainment complex – but its opening is dependant on the venue winning a casino license.
Resorts World at the NEC is due to open in 2012 if the Solihull Metropolitan Borough Council announces a favourable decision early next year.
The venue will feature a four star hotel, a spa, bars, restaurants, conference facilities and a casino.
The NEC is working with casino operator Genting Stanley on the project.
"The state-of-the-art resort will support our vision for Destination NEC offering a work, rest and play environment for all of our customers and allowing us to compete with venues across the world offering a genuine destination experience" said NEC Group chief executive Paul Thandi.
The NEC Group hopes the development will increase economic impact in Birmingham, providing jobs and business opportunities in the area.
Separately, the NEC Group's new Convention Centre Dublin (CCD) has already confirmed £16.5m of business, and it is not opening until 1 September 2010.
"All of the confirmed events are international," said CCD chief executive Nick Waight.
The CCD will offer 44,000sqm of space and is located on Spencer Dock. The building handover is due in May 2010 with complete build finished by August 2010.
